Li₄V₂O₂F₆ is a mixed-anion lithium vanadium oxide fluoride compound belonging to the family of advanced lithium-ion cathode materials and solid-state electrolyte candidates. This is a research-phase material being investigated for next-generation energy storage systems where the combined oxygen and fluoride ligands offer potential improvements in electrochemical stability, ionic conductivity, and structural robustness compared to conventional oxide-only cathodes. Engineers would consider this compound where high energy density, thermal stability, or fast lithium-ion transport is critical, though commercial adoption remains limited pending further development and scale-up feasibility.
